The latest officially reported population of Bhutan was 791,524 in 2024 vs 14,256,567 people in Rwanda in 2024. In 2026, based on the adjusted UN estimation, the current Bhutan's population is 802,266 people compared to 14,893,241 in Rwanda.
Population statistics:
- Rwanda's population is 18.6 times bigger than Bhutan's.
- Bhutan is ranked the 163rd most populous country in the world, while Rwanda is the 77th.
- The countries together account for 0.19% of the world: 0.01% for Bhutan vs 0.18% for Rwanda.
- For the last 10 years, Bhutan has had an average growth rate of +0.8% per year vs +2.31% in Rwanda.
- Since 2006, the population of Bhutan has increased from 671K people to 802K (19.6% growth), while Rwanda has grown from 9.3M to 14.9M (60.2% growth).
- Bhutan is projected to reach its peak in 2052 at 884K people compared to the peak of 32.8M people in 2100 for Rwanda.

From 2006 to 2016, the population of Bhutan increased by 77,067 people (a 11.5% growth), while Rwanda gained 2,619,937 people (a 28.2% growth).
For the next 10 years, from 2016 to 2026, Bhutan gained 54,400 (a 7.27% growth), while Rwanda's population increased by 2,974,058 (a 25% growth).
Bhutan was ranked 161st most populous country in 2006 and is 163rd in 2026. Rwanda was ranked 86th in 2006 and ranked 77th now.
The UN's World Population Prospects forecasts that with changing growth rate trends in 24 years (in 2050) Bhutan's population will grow by 9.98% to 882,337 people and will still be ranked 163rd. The population of Rwanda will increase by 52.5% to 22,707,896 people and rank change from 77th to 72nd.
